Chou Collection, Lower Volume
Radical: Woman (nǚ)
Entry: Na
Kangxi Strokes: 7
Page 256, Entry 34
Broad Rhymes (Guangyun): Pronounced na. To take a wife. Another interpretation is to collect items. Another interpretation is the appearance of a child who is plump. From the poetry of Han Yu: Ba yan shou wan na.
Collected Rhymes (Jiyun): Pronounced na. To take, to enter.
Also pronounced dan. The meaning is the same.
Also used as a name for women. Empress Shunlie of the Later Han Dynasty was named Na.
